Robinson Jackson scoops two awards
Robinson Jackson Estate Agency Partnership has scooped two awards at the Kentish Times Property Awards 2008.
It was crowned Residential Multi-branch Estate Agency of the Year and also received a special award for its Gravesend branch’s trading volumes at the ceremony, which was held at the Marriot Hotel in Bexley, Kent last month.
RJEA was founded in 1961 and has more than 30 branches and departments with 250 staff throughout South East London and Kent.
Each team is owned and managed by an individual partner.
